The December 2018 cover of Greater Utica Magazine explores the history of Woolworth’s in Utica NY, a name that became synonymous with downtown retail and everyday shopping for generations. The story of Woolworth’s in Utica NY begins on February 22, 1879, when Frank Winfield Woolworth opened his very first “Great Five Cent Store” on Bleecker Street.

Although this first Woolworth’s in Utica NY was short-lived and closed within three months, it marked the beginning of a retail revolution. Woolworth went on to refine his concept elsewhere, eventually building one of the most successful retail chains in American history.

The brand later returned, and Woolworth’s in Utica NY became a thriving and beloved downtown destination for decades. Known for its affordability and wide selection of goods, it played a major role in the city’s commercial life and remains a nostalgic symbol of Utica’s retail past.
